DESCRIPTION:Registration Open\, but some classes are full:  Jackie du Plessis will be teaching three classes at Hobby House. Descriptions below and each is individually priced. \nThursday\, July 25:  Carmen’s Sampler:  \nIn Jackie’s own words: “Carmen’s exquisite Spanish-styled sampler glows beautifully\, as the light reflects on the different Satin-stitch combinations. Most of the stitches are worked over three linen threads on 45 ct Legacy Linen with luxurious Soie de Paris. The sampler measures 39″h x 13.5″w\, and while this may sound daunting\, your love and appreciation of Carmen’s sampler grows as you explore the bands and motives. The motives seen in the center section are stitched as Cross-stitch over-two and only the personal information section is stitched over-two. The color combinations of Carmen’s Sampler is soothing and graceful\, it truly is a work of art.” \n10am-6pm:  Includes lunch and cocktail reception \nFriday\, July 26:  Berrylicious \nJackie described this class as:  “Strawberry\, blueberries\, blackberries and cherries\, some tart\, and many super sweet. Filling my basket and contented heart.” \nThese two sentences describe Berrylicious perfectly! Attendees will have the option of a painted ($775) or an unpainted ($650) cherry wood basket with a delicate swing-handle\, decorated with a stitched linen panel. (Deposit price is the same. Registered attendees will be asked their preference at a later date.) The stitched linen panel will be used to create the exterior of the basket’s body\, plus a pincushion adorned with stitched berries will be mounted to the bottom interior of basket. The stitching features all things berries and uses only the finest of hand-dyed silk fiber\, AVAS silk. \n10am-6pm:  Includes lunch and cocktail reception \nSaturday\, July 27-Sunday\, July 28:  Sadeli Workbox Class \nThis is the fourth in the Anglo-Indian Workbox series that debuts at Hobby House Needleworks. \nA soothing color palette featuring subtle greens and metallics are used to create the stitched linen panels that are used to produce the a three-dimensional Sadeli workbox with a sarcophagus top panel. The interior will feature functional storage areas to hold and store your cherished needlework tools and supplies. \n10am-6pm:  Includes lunch and cocktail reception \n  \n  \n

SUMMARY:Sampler Schools: Ackworth\, Westtown\, Bristol Workshop
DESCRIPTION: \n\n\n \n\nRegistration Open:  Kathleen Littleton of Cross Stitch Antiques will be offering three samplers from her private collection from each of the three schools. She will be lecturing on the significance of how these three schools came to be\, the history of the schools\, their unique contributions to the sampler style\, how needlework samplers were part of the school curriculum and for what purposes\, among other topics. \nThe price of the class will include one fully kitted school sampler and charts for the other two schools.\n\n\n\nPreliminary Schedule:\n\nFriday\, May 17\, 2024\n\n1:00pm Open stitch room available\n\n\n4:00pm Check-In Begins\n\n\n5:00-7:00pm Welcome Reception  \n\n\nBuffet Dinner\, photo opps\, models\, and cocktails.
